         <description><![CDATA[<div><strong>Last year, BLM protests took over North America. The BLM movement is about racial injustices in our society. BLM protests against many problems like police brutality, racial profiling, and that the large majority of jails are occupied by African-Americans. In Canada, many of these happen for our indigenous people but what I want to focus on is their high incarceration rate.</strong></div><div><br></div><div><strong>Indigenous people occupy most of the cells in Canadian jails. They have the highest crime rate for any community in all of Canada. A third of Canadian jails are indigenous people. That’s extremely worrisome and surprising by itself. That should be enough information for there to be a big change. But what will show the importance of this problem, even more, is that they represent 4% of all Canadians. This means that every 4 in 100 people in Canada are indigenous and every 1 in 3 people in jail are also indigenous. They represent more than 50% of the population incarcerated in prisons in Alberta and 15% in Quebec which is the lowest in all of Canada. What’s even more troubling is that other populations have decreased by 10% since 2010 when the aboriginal population has increased by 44% of convictions. This is a major problem in Canada that needs to be stopped. This is because of the harsh conditions they live in, like extreme poverty, substance abuse, and racism. With all this in thought, they also represent 24% of victims of homicide in Canada. Every 9 in 100000 male natives are killed which is 6 times higher than the non-indigenous man. This number is continuously increasing every year since 2014.</strong></div><div><br></div><div><strong>This is a major problem that should be known nationwide.
